Peace is on a roll! 2025 ACU British Extreme Enduro Championship Round 4 - Results & Pictures

Dan Peace continued his great run of form by winning the weekend’s Mini Ravines Extreme Enduro run by Dirtbike Action at Helmsley, which was Round 4 of the 2025 ACU British Extreme Enduro Championship.

Rounding out the Pro podium were Jack Price in second and Adrian Scales in third.

Other victors were Bert Boam in the Experts, Jamie Rowntree in the Clubman, Nathan Evans in the Elite Vets, Chris Day in the Over 40’s, Grant Gillender in the Over 50’s, Chris Pickard in the Sportsman and Alex Andrews in the Youth.
